Neurotoxins (Botox, Dysport, Xeomin)

Injectable neurotoxins that temporarily relax facial muscles to smooth wrinkles and fine lines. Commonly used on forehead lines, crow's feet, and frown lines between the eyebrows.

About This Treatment

Neurotoxin injections are the most popular non-surgical aesthetic treatment in the United States, with millions of procedures performed each year. At Lodi MedSpa, we offer all three FDA-approved neurotoxin brands — Botox, Dysport, and Xeomin — so your provider can select the ideal product for your unique facial anatomy and aesthetic goals. Each brand contains botulinum toxin type A, which works by temporarily blocking nerve signals to targeted muscles, allowing the overlying skin to relax and smooth out.

The treatment areas most commonly addressed with neurotoxins include horizontal forehead lines, vertical frown lines between the eyebrows (the glabellar complex), crow's feet at the outer corners of the eyes, bunny lines on the nose, lip flip (relaxing the upper lip to show a bit more lip without filler), and masseter reduction for jawline slimming. Advanced applications include treating chin dimpling, neck bands (platysma), and even excessive sweating (hyperhidrosis).

Frequently Asked Questions

What is the difference between Botox, Dysport, and Xeomin?
All three are botulinum toxin type A and work by temporarily relaxing muscles. Botox is the most well-known brand, Dysport tends to spread slightly more and may kick in faster (2-3 days vs 3-7), and Xeomin is a 'naked' neurotoxin with no accessory proteins, which may reduce the chance of developing resistance over time. Your provider will recommend the best option based on your anatomy and goals.
How many units of Botox will I need?
The number of units varies by treatment area and individual anatomy. Common ranges are 10-30 units for forehead lines, 20-25 units for frown lines, and 12-24 units for crow's feet. During your consultation, your provider will assess your facial muscles and recommend the appropriate dosage for natural-looking results.
Does Botox hurt?
Most patients describe the sensation as a tiny pinch. The needles used are extremely fine, and the injections are quick. We can apply a topical numbing cream before treatment if you are concerned about discomfort. The entire procedure typically takes 15-30 minutes.
Can I get Botox during my lunch break?
Absolutely. Neurotoxin injections are one of the fastest aesthetic treatments available. The actual injection process takes about 10-15 minutes, with no downtime afterward. You can return to work, errands, or social activities immediately. We just recommend avoiding strenuous exercise for 24 hours.
How often do I need to repeat Botox treatments?
Most patients return every 3-4 months to maintain results. Over time, with consistent treatments, some patients find they can extend the interval between sessions as the muscles gradually weaken and require less product to achieve the same effect.
